1 DATASHEETNI 94748 DO, 5 V to 30 V, Sourcing, 1 s Screw-terminal or spring-terminal connectivity CompactDAQ counter compatibility 250 Vrms, CAT II, channel-to-earth isolationThe NI 9474 is a digital output module for CompactDAQ and CompactRIO systems. Eachchannel is compatible with 5 V to 30 V signals and features 2,300 Vrms of transientovervoltage protection between the output channels and the backplane. Each channel also hasan LED that indicates the state of that channel. 10 WeightNI 9474 with screw terminal150 g ( oz)NI 9474 with spring terminal139 g ( oz)Safety VoltagesConnect only voltages that are within the following VDC maximumNI 9474 Datasheet | National Instruments | 7 IsolationChannel-to-channelNoneChannel-t o-earth groundContinuous250 Vrms, Measurement Category IIWithstand2,300 Vrms, verified by a 5 s dielectricwithstand testMeasurement Category II is for measurements performed on circuits directly connected to theelectrical distribution system. This category refers to local-level electrical distribution, such asthat provided by a standard wall outlet, for example, 115 V for or 230 V for Do not connect the NI 9474 to signals or use for measurements withinMeasurement Categories III or (UL)Class I, Division 2, Groups A, B, C, D, T4;Class I, Zone 2, AEx nA IIC T4 Canada (C-UL)Class I, Division 2, Groups A, B, C, D, T4.
